What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Hadoop Python developer?

To thrive as a Hadoop Python Developer, you need a strong understanding of distributed computing, Hadoop ecosystem components (like HDFS, MapReduce, Hive, or Pig), and advanced Python programming skills, often supported by a degree in computer science or related field. Familiarity with tools such as Apache Spark, Sqoop, and workflow schedulers (like Oozie or Airflow), along with experience in handling big data platforms, is typically required. Probl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ective communication help developers collaborate with teams and translate business requirements into scalable data solutions. These skills and qualifications are essential for efficiently processing and analyzing large datasets, ensuring data reliability, and driving business insights.

What is a Hadoop Python developer?

A Hadoop Python developer is a software professional who specializes in using Python programming language to develop, implement, and maintain applications that process and analyze large datasets within the Hadoop ecosystem. They leverage Python libraries like PySpark to write scalable data processing scripts, interact with Hadoop components such as HDFS, and optimize big data workflows. These developers play a critical role in building data pipelines, performing data transformation, and supporting analytics projects in organizations that handle vast amounts of data.

How do Hadoop Python developers typically collaborate with data engineers and analysts on large-scale data projects?

Hadoop Python developers frequently work alongside data engineers and analysts to design, implement, and optimize data pipelines for handling vast datasets. They are responsible for writing Python scripts that interface with Hadoop components, ensuring data is processed efficiently and meets project requirements. Regular communication with data engineers helps align on infrastructure and architectural decisions, while close collaboration with analysts ensures data outputs are accurate and actionable. Agile methodologies and daily stand-ups are common, fostering teamwork and quick problem-solving.
